Key Nutrients for Hormonal Balance and Reproductive Health
Nutrients like folate, omega-3 fatty acids, zinc, and antioxidants play vital roles in supporting egg quality and sperm motility. Folate aids in DNA synthesis, while zinc contributes to testosterone production and ovulation regulation. Deficiencies in these areas can lead to longer time to pregnancy or higher risks of complications.
- Folate: Found in leafy greens, legumes, and fortified grains; supports cell division during early pregnancy and reduces neural tube defect risks.
- Omega-3s: Present in fatty fish such as salmon and sardines; reduces inflammation and improves blood flow to reproductive organs while supporting embryo implantation.
- Vitamin D: Critical for hormone regulation and immune function; sources include fortified dairy, sunlight exposure, and fatty fish.
- Coenzyme Q10: An antioxidant that enhances mitochondrial function in eggs and sperm, potentially improving energy production at the cellular level.
- Iron and B vitamins: Essential for women to maintain healthy menstrual cycles and prevent anemia that can affect ovulation.
- Selenium and vitamin C: Key for men to protect sperm from oxidative damage and improve morphology and count.
Gender-specific needs also matter. Women benefit from consistent intake of these nutrients across the menstrual cycle, while men should prioritize daily sources to maintain optimal semen parameters. Blood testing can identify gaps before starting a plan.
Comparing Evidence-Based Dietary Approaches
Two prominent strategies stand out for fertility support: the Mediterranean diet and antioxidant-focused eating patterns. The Mediterranean approach prioritizes whole grains, olive oil, nuts, seeds, vegetables, and moderate fish intake. It has been linked to improved ovulation rates, better embryo quality, and reduced inflammation in multiple clinical observations.
Antioxidant-rich diets emphasize berries, dark leafy greens, green tea, dark chocolate, and colorful produce to combat oxidative stress, a known contributor to reduced fertility in both sexes. While both patterns overlap significantly, the Mediterranean diet often delivers broader cardiovascular and metabolic benefits that indirectly support reproductive function. Individuals may combine elements of each for optimal results based on personal preferences and lab results.

Gender-Specific Custom Nutrition Plans
For women, plans focus on cycle syncing with iron-rich meals during menstruation and phytoestrogen sources like flaxseeds and lentils in the follicular phase. Luteal phase emphasis shifts toward magnesium-rich foods such as pumpkin seeds and dark chocolate to ease PMS and support progesterone levels. Sample daily targets include 400 mcg folate, 1.5 grams of omega-3s, and adequate protein from plant and lean animal sources.
Men’s plans stress zinc-heavy foods such as oysters, beef, and pumpkin seeds to boost sperm parameters, alongside selenium from Brazil nuts and vitamin E from almonds. Both genders benefit from limiting processed sugars and trans fats that can disrupt hormone production. Combining these strategies with moderate protein intake ensures sustainable energy without excess weight gain that can disrupt hormones.
Step-by-Step Guide to Building Personalized Plans
- Assess baseline health through bloodwork for nutrient levels, hormone panels, and inflammatory markers.
- Identify primary goals such as hormonal balance, improved egg quality, enhanced sperm health, or overall cycle regularity.
- Select a core diet framework like Mediterranean or antioxidant emphasis, then layer in personal food preferences and cultural traditions.
- Incorporate daily targets for key nutrients using food-first strategies supplemented only when testing indicates need.
- Adjust portions and timing based on lifestyle factors including work schedules, exercise routines, and any existing medical conditions.
- Re-evaluate progress every four to six weeks using symptom tracking, cycle data, and follow-up lab tests to refine the plan further.
Sample Meal Ideas for Fertility Support
Breakfast options include Greek yogurt topped with mixed berries, chia seeds, and walnuts for a boost of antioxidants and omega-3s, or overnight oats made with flax milk, spinach, and banana.
Lunch ideas feature grilled salmon over quinoa with spinach, cherry tomatoes, avocado, and olive oil dressing, or a hearty lentil soup paired with whole-grain bread and a side salad.
Dinner examples include baked chicken with sweet potatoes, broccoli, and turmeric seasoning, or a tofu stir-fry with colorful vegetables and brown rice drizzled in sesame oil.
Snacks can consist of a handful of almonds with an apple, carrot sticks with hummus, or a green smoothie blending kale, pineapple, and flaxseed. These meals provide balanced macronutrients while delivering targeted micronutrients throughout the day.

Tracking Methods and Lifestyle Integration
Use digital apps to log meals, track cycle symptoms, monitor ovulation, and record energy levels or mood changes. Popular options allow photo uploads of plates and nutrient breakdowns to ensure targets are met consistently. Combine nutrition strategies with stress reduction practices such as daily yoga, meditation, or nature walks. Adequate sleep of seven to nine hours supports hormone production, while moderate exercise like brisk walking or swimming improves circulation without overtaxing the body.

Frequently Asked Questions
Which supplements complement these plans?
Prenatal vitamins containing methylfolate and omega-3s serve as common starters. Targeted additions like CoQ10 or vitamin D may be considered after professional consultation and lab confirmation of low levels.
How long until results appear?
Improvements in egg and sperm quality often require three to six months of consistent adherence due to the time needed for follicle and sperm development cycles.
Can these plans work alongside medical treatments?
Yes, nutrition strategies frequently enhance outcomes when coordinated with fertility specialists and can be adjusted around procedures such as IVF or IUI.
Are there foods to avoid?
Limit high-mercury fish, excessive caffeine, processed meats, and sugary beverages that may negatively affect hormone balance and gamete quality.
